Porridge Sago Ambon: Indonesian Maluku porridge

Maybe some don't know about this one porridge, Ambon Sago Porridge. typical food originating from the Maluku region, Indonesian. Sago Ambon porridge tastes sweet and savory with the addition of coconut milk sauce. When it enters the mouth, it feels like there are chewy soft granules. Ingredients:

  1. 1 pack of Ambon sago
  2. 400 ml thin coconut milk
  3. 50 grams of brown sugar
  4. 75 sugar, can be added according to taste
  5. salt to taste
  6. 1 sheet of pandan leaves conclude


Ingredients for coconut milk:
  1. coconut milk sauce, boil the sauce ingredients until it boils
  2. 500 ml thick coconut milk
  3. pinch of salt
  4. 2 pandan leaves


How to make:

  • Soak the ambon sago for about 1 hour, kneading it occasionally until it crumbles into grains, strain and rinse again with clean water.
  • Bring the thin coconut milk and other ingredients to a boil.
  • Add sago, stir well until thickened, adjust to desired thickness, remove from heat, serve with coconut milk sauce
